NextSeed continues expansion with Reg CF offering

January 5, 2020

NextSeed had recently oversaw a Reg D offering for a real estate investment and now it's looking for more.

NextSeed started life as a platform acting as a bank replacement. Small businesses could raise debt capital, first under the Texas intrastate exemption (no longer in use) and then under Reg CF.

Reg CF is notoriously difficult to scale and turn into a profitable business thus NextSeed has been expanding its portfolio of offerings and securities exemptions available to issuers.

The first Reg real estate investment, “ARRIVE Albuquerque” is only available to accredited investors.

Also recently, NextSeed made an additional announcement sharing that ARRIVE Alburquerque will also be the platforms first offering where NextSeed has a significant stake in the game.
